My yellow light came on just under a quarter tank yesterday at 237 miles. I drove it to 275 miles and filled up with 22.9 gallons (about 12.38 mpg). It was hovering at about 1/16th of a tank according to the gauge. I'm just gonna live with it. I don't think I'm having quite the problem others are having. I figure that I can drive safely (sans 4x4 ops.) up to 300 miles before a fill up in town.

I'm waiting for my next service to document it. My light comes on at different times so I've learned not to rely on it. Sometimes it will comes on just below 1/4 tank and sometimes it's almost empty before it lights up. I usually fill-up just under the 1/4 tank mark because of the other problem of it spitting-up if it's empty. I haven't had the spitting out gas problem yet and I'm not going to chance it.
